History and Origins

Construction and Academic Beginnings

The Mathematical Tower forms an integral part of the University of Wrocław’s main Baroque building, situated at plac Uniwersytecki 1 on the southern bank of the Oder River. The university itself began as a Jesuit college in 1702, with the main building constructed between 1728 and 1739 by architect Christoph Tausch, influenced by prominent European observatories such as the Clementinum in Prague (Astronomical Heritage).

The tower was completed in 1791 under Johann Blasius Peintner, crowning the university’s main structure with a large terrace designed for astronomical observation. The Jesuit observatory, formally established in 1732, became one of Central Europe’s earliest academic observatories, focusing on precise geographical measurements and solar eclipse observations.

Development as a Scientific Hub

Academic astronomy at the university flourished under Professor Longinus Anton Jungnitz, who established the observatory in the Mathematical Tower in 1790–1791. He installed a meridian line modeled after those in Rome and Paris, solidifying the tower’s reputation as a center for astronomical research (Astronomical Heritage).


Architectural and Scientific Features

Baroque Design and Ornamentation

The Mathematical Tower is a prominent example of Baroque architecture, rising approximately 42 meters above the university’s main building (Nomads Travel Guide). Its entrance, reached via the grand Imperial Staircase, is adorned with royal blue and gold details and the double-headed Habsburg eagle, reflecting the building’s imperial heritage.

Inside, visitors encounter ornate stuccowork, frescoes, and allegorical paintings representing the university’s dedication to the Seven Liberal Arts, including astronomy, mathematics, and music (Wikipedia).

Scientific Apparatus and Features

  • Meridian Line: Installed in 1791 for measuring the solar noon, modeled after major European observatories.
  • Observation Terrace: An open-air platform that provides 360-degree panoramic views of Wrocław and beyond.
  • Historic Instruments: The museum displays original scientific devices, such as a Dollond Transit instrument, a Repeating Circle, a Universal Instrument by Reichenbach, Utzschneider & Liebherr, and an 18th-century mural quadrant.

Artistic Symbolism

The terrace is decorated with four statues by Franz Mangoldt, each symbolizing a discipline of the classical quadrivium: astronomy, geometry, arithmetic, and music. These sculptures underscore the university’s commitment to the harmonious relationship between science and the arts (Nomads Travel Guide).


Academic and Cultural Significance

Throughout the 19th and early 20th centuries, the Mathematical Tower played a central role in the university’s scientific endeavors, specializing in astronomy, meteorology, and geodesy. It also became an emblem of the city’s intellectual and cultural identity, surviving political upheavals and wartime destruction.

Today, the tower remains a symbol of the enduring pursuit of knowledge and cultural continuity in Wrocław, hosting exhibitions, educational programs, and special events as part of the University of Wrocław Museum.


Visiting the Mathematical Tower

Opening Hours

  • Tuesday to Sunday: 10:00 AM – 5:00 PM
  • Closed: Mondays and public holidays
  • Last Entry: 30 minutes before closing

Check the Museum’s official website for seasonal updates and any changes during university events.

Ticket Information

  • General Admission: ~15 PLN
  • Discounted Tickets: ~10 PLN (students, seniors)
  • Family and Group Rates: Available
  • Combined Tickets: For both museum exhibits and the observation deck
  • Where to Buy: At the museum entrance or online via the official website

Accessibility

  • Access to the tower is via a historic staircase (~200 steps); there is no elevator.
  • The upper levels and observation terrace may not be suitable for visitors with mobility impairments.
  • Multilingual signage (Polish, English, German) is provided.

Events and Preservation

The Mathematical Tower and the University Museum host lectures, cultural events, and exhibitions highlighting Wrocław’s academic legacy. Post-war restorations have ensured the preservation of its architectural and scientific features, including ongoing work to maintain the meridian line and allegorical statues (Trasa dla Bobasa).
